General Purpose

The Area Supervisor is a member of Store Leadership responsible for a specific area of the Store and for general operations and supervision when functioning as the Manager on Duty. Responsibilities include opening/closing the Store, supervising Associates, ensuring a friendly, easy-to-shop environment, maintaining merchandise presentation, and keeping a clean work area. They also execute and supervise Company operational processes as needed.

Essential

Functions Maintaining Safe & Secure Environments
  • Safety is the priority; practice safe behaviors at all times.
  • Maintain awareness on the sales floor to create a safe and secure shopping environment; correct or report unsafe conditions to Store Leadership.
  • Oversee building security, EAS devices, Cash Office security, armored carrier pick-ups, and register area.
  • Remove clutter and ensure clear egress to emergency exits.
  • Responsible for customer safety including accident prevention and emergency procedures; test fire alarm systems as scheduled and respond to after-hours alarms when requested.
Customer Service
  • Treat all Customers, Associates, and leaders with respect; demonstrate courtesy, friendliness, and professionalism.
Personal and Store Brand
  • Represent and support the Company brand; maintain a professional appearance and ensure adherence to the Dress Code.
  • Keep all areas clean, well-maintained, and merchandised to standard; manage daily trash removal.
General Merchandising
  • Ensure recovery, sizing, and markdowns meet Company standards; assist with merchandise receipt when needed; process merchandise with urgency.
  • Oversee inventory and back-stock, stockroom cleanliness, and floor replenishment; ensure back-stock is secured per policy.
  • Support monthly presentation guidelines and manage floor moves and promotional signing.
Loss Prevention
  • Follow Loss Prevention programs and maintain a strong customer service presence on the sales floor.
  • Safeguard confidential information and ensure proper handling of cash and merchandise; maintain PVM system.
  • Conduct code inspections as required and maximize productivity by minimizing unnecessary steps.
Front End Supervision & Operations
  • Enforce Company Best Practices and ensure Front End standards are met; manage line pace to reduce customer wait times.
  • Train and coach Associates on cash register procedures, shortage controls, and Front End operations.
  • Manage break schedules, equipment functionality, and Front End recovery; ensure proper go-back handling and scanning.
Fitting Rooms
  • Maintain cleanliness and audit garment tags; ensure go-back compliance and proper ticketing and security tagging as needed.
Administrative Duties
  • Ensure cash pulls and bank deposits follow policy; manage Front End control, refunds, approvals, and cash handling per procedures.
  • Assist with payroll administration and scheduling as needed; perform other duties as assigned by Store Manager.
